About the company
Legacy Minerals Holdings Limited engages in the acquisition and exploration of gold and copper projects in Australia. The company also explores for silver, zinc, lead, nickel, cobalt, platinum group elements, and base metal deposits. The company was founded in 2017 and is based in Bathurst, Australia.

How we calculate Fair Value
Each company is valued through a stack of independent intrinsic-value models (DCF variants, residual-income, multiples and more), blended into one family-balanced consensus and weighted by how much trustworthy data backs it. A separate quality layer scores the fundamentals. Every input is real reported data — nothing guessed.
